Centrifugal Fans & Blowers – Associated Benefits and Types

There are several types of centrifugal blowers with unique design characteristics, performance capabilities, and benefits. These processed industrial fans are used for high-pressure exercises by a variety of assiduousness, as well as air pollution systems. Centrifugal fans work to boost airstream pressure by turning a series of blades (impeller) mounted on a circuitous core. Centrifugal fans accelerate the air as well as changes the direction of the air flowing outward, hourly by 90 degrees. In addition, these nuts produce a steady zephyr. 

Introductory Types of Centrifugal Fans 

Below, there are six most common types of centrifugal industrial fans, each with a unique blade configuration. 

  • Forward Curved Fans

Also known as a squirrel corral fan due to the wheel type. The Centrifugal fan’s impeller is forward and small. In addition, the blades arch in the same direction as the pirouette of the wheel. Because the impeller, shaft, case, and addresses are delicately made, there are some limitations for sustainability when used for cultivated exercises. Notwithstanding, this fan is great for low-speed and low-pressure exercises. 

  •  Backward Inclined Fans

There are three standard blade types for this fan, including curled single consistency, flat single consistency, and curled airfoil. In addition to being heavy and larger, the blades are designed to move out from the pirouette of the wheel. For operation, this fan produces the top speed. It’s also considered more effective than other fan types. Normally, the backward inclined fan is the noncasual choice for low-pressure and high-volume exercises. 

  •  Radial Blade Fan

This centrifugal fan is applied to as a paddlewheel nut because the impeller has multiple alike zonked flat blades that extend standing to the direction of spin for the wheel. Sometimes, this type of nut has side frames. Producing medium to high pressure and being qualified to move a late mass or volume of fluid, this sucker is best suited for material supervision. 

  • Airfoil Blade Fan

The blades of this fan are concave and backward inclined. So, the fan is ideal for handling large volumes of clean air while operating at static pressures that are low to moderate. This fan also runs at a major speed and produces an optimum edge compared to the backward inclined fan. Able to handle large volumes of air that can be used in argued and forced draft fan’s bore for a wide range of employments. 

  •  Radial Tip Fan

These centrifugal fans have blades with a backward and bending configuration while cupping in the direction of gyration for the wheel. Although compact, the fan works great for employments of high-volume blow in which the condition for pressure is enormously high. 

  •  Inline Fan

Inline centrifugal fans are rugged. In addition, the backward inclined auto is enclosed in a tube-axial armor. This medium-duty fan is less effective and, so, used primarily when a low-pressure blow is bored.

Role Of Centrifugal Fans & Blowers in Steel And Iron Industry

In India, the importance of the steel and iron industry can not be denied, as all other industries majorly depend on it. Steel is one of the necessary elements needed to manufacture different machinery as required by various industries. A wide range of consumer products, equipment, construction materials is needed for different fields such as scientific, medical, and defense. Steel is basically produced to utilize either in the blast and electric furnaces. Now, centrifugal fans are widely used in such processes.

These industrial fans and blowers are used for heating and drying iron pellets, cool products, and provide combustion air that cleans waste gases along with handling dust particles. In a blast furnace, these industrial fans needed to blow preheated blast into the furnace during the manufacturing process.

Choose Right Industrial Fan For The Right Process

As noticed, centrifugal fans have various applications for the steel and iron industry. Using the wrong industrial fan can increase several challenges related to dust load, speed, tear, wear, etc. Thus, it is important to select and use the right industrial fan for the right process to ensure that it is coming from a reliable manufacturer.

Sintering Plant

Sinter can also be said as the porous mass of the iron and other materials which fused at high temperatures. In the sintering process, coke fines, iron ore fines, and flux are needed to heat together which creates a mass of semi-molten. The mass solidified for porous nodules that can also be called the iron sinters fed into blast furnaces. 

A wide variety of fans is involved in a sintering plant that includes industrial cooling fans, industrial hot air fans, forced draught combustion fans, induced draught fans, etc. Hot air fans are used to recover heat from sintered products for the process of cooling and recycling fans that are used to cool sintered iron nodules. Draught fans are used to draw away gases during the dust removal system. Forced draught combustion fans help to provide the air that is necessary to support the combustion process.

Pelletization Plant

Pelletization plant involves two types of industrial fans for the process i.e. FD fan, and ID fan. The ID fan is used to recycle the heat from waste gases from the kiln that helps to heat and dry pellets. After this stage of pellet drying, gases used to be forced through the process of dust removal.

On the other hand, FD fans are used to supply the air from surroundings to cool down pellets that are helpful in the handling of downstream material. These fans draw away dust from gases that are coming from the dust removal system. It releases clean air out to the atmosphere.

Coke Making

Centrifugal fans are also used in the coke and ovens industries for multiple purposes. It provides air combustion to coke ovens, removes the off-gas, and collects by-products that are created in coke-oven. Industrial centrifugal fans are important to reduce the water temperature that is used to cool the blast furnace.

Blast Furnace

Producing steel and iron with the process of blast furnace, centrifugal industrial fans are used for three purposes i.e. cooling, heating, and exhaust. A heating fan supplies the preheated air, also known as the blast air, into a furnace to burn up coke. The furnace gas from the oven draws away with the help of exhaust fans.

All About Axial Flow Fan – Features, Uses, and Applications

The basic principle to operate the axial flow fan is that the airflow direction is parallel to its rotor shaft. Its blades force the air linear to shaft. By doing so, they create a high flow rate and achieve a bigger volume of airflow. In such an operation, the movement of air that is created is of lower pressure. It generally requires the input of lower power for the operation.

Important Features of Axial Flow Fans 

  • One of the main distinguishing components of the axial flow fan is its impeller. They are associated with a number of blades of range from 2 to 20 as per the requirements of design and performance. The axial flow fan is connected to a powerful motor that is assembled with a housing design to create parallel airflow through the fan.
  • Axial flow fans are energy-efficient with the ability to generate greater movement of air by using less energy with high-cost savings. As compared to other types of fans, they offer savings of power usage up to 40%.

Fundamental Benefits of Using Pulse Jet Bag Filters in Industries

The pulse jet bag filter is also known as pulse jet dust collector or pulse jet baghouse that works as the dry filtration system for self-cleaning. This dust collector cleaning equipment or system helps to remove the particulate matter from the internal surface of the filter media using compressed air bursts. The pulse jet bag filter is a common air pollution control equipment that is usually found in most workplaces including factories, warehouses, plants, etc. to meet air quality and safety requirements of the workplace to comply with the requirements of the Environmental Protection Agency (EPA).

We manufacture and design customized high-quality pulse jet dust collector equipment and custom components to meet a wide variety of environments within different industries. The pulse jet bag filter does not contain any moving parts. Thus it offers reliable and continuous operations with an efficiency of superior filtration that is engineered to remove and collect potentially harmful particulate and gas fumes that enters into the work environment and make it unhealthy. 

Pulse jet bag dust collectors derived their name from short bursts or “pulses” of the compressed air that is used to clean the filter or the bag. In the pulse jet dust collector system, the dust collects on its external surface where it forms like a cake of dust. Either based on the pressure drop or timed basis, when the formed dust cake got to an appropriate thickness, then the controller activated its sequential pulse into the interiors of the pulse jet bag filters. one or more rows at the same time knock the dust cake and it gets freed from the filter and falls due to the gravity into a hopper and removes. The compressed air pulse mechanics are associated with an induced draft of additional air through the venturi nozzle. It creates a ripple effect and shock wave on the filter bag that helps to enhance its mechanical force at the very initial blast of the compressed air by itself. It helps to dislodge the particles of dust off the fabric.

Why Use Pulse Jet Bag Dust Collector In Industries?

Using the pulse jet filtration systems in your industry has various advantages as compared to other systems used for dust collection. The fundamental benefit to using pulse jet bag filters is their ability to clean online effectively. The duration of the compressed air within the pulse is typically in the range of 100 to 200 microseconds, which facilitates operations 24/7 without any kind of interruption to ventilation of the dusty air. Also, there is no shut-down period for cleaning bag filters.

The pulse jet bag filter and dust collector is incredibly versatile, in the terms of temperature range, gas, and pressure stream chemistries.
